The present invention relates to an off-axis infrared optical system with a concept of an asymmetric field of view. The area of the surface of the area, which is a monitoring criterion on the entire image screen, is vertically positioned below the center of an image to cause a monitoring image screen (20) of a ski area, whereby the attention is focused to occupy a relatively wide area, thus improving the monitoring effects. The position of the surface of the sea in regards to an object to be monitored is made by adjusting an incidence angle of infrared rays received to an object lens (7). By including an object lens adjuster (10) with an installation angle (x) coupled to the object lens (7), a vertical field of view above the surface of the sea can be made wide while making a vertical field of view below the surface of the sea of little interest narrow with respect to the incidence angle of the infrared rays. More specifically, a reference surface of the sea can be moved to a desired position with a field of view of the off-axis infrared optical system, thereby efficiently adjusting the field of view of a region of interest, reducing a load on the optical design, and improving performance.
